ST. JOHN — An unidentified man was recovered from Coral Bay Harbor without vital signs Sunday morning after a citizen reported seeing a body floating in the water, according to the V.I. Police Department.

VIPD was notified of the discovery at approximately 10:26 a.m. on July 12.

Responding officers met with a citizen who said they had been in the Coral Bay Harbor area when they noticed the body in the water.

Emergency responders searched the area and located an unidentified Caucasian man floating face down.

Members of St. John Rescue removed the man from the water. He had no vital signs.

The investigation remains ongoing as authorities work to identify the deceased and determine the circumstances surrounding his death.
